A Bronze and Gray Smokey Eye with the Urban Decay Dangerous Palette
STEP 1: Urban Decay 24/7 Glide-On Shadow Pencil in Sin applied as a base over the entire eyelid

STEP 2: Eyeshadow in Deeper applied on the lids, in the crease and along the lower lash line with a fluffy domed blending brush

STEP 3: Eyeshadow in Ace applied to the lash line, barely into the crease and on the lower half of the lash line with a flat eyeshadow brush

STEP 4: Urban Decay 24/7 Glide-On Eye Pencil in Perversion (from the new holiday 2012 Ocho Loco 24/7 Glide-On Eye Pencil Set) applied on the upper lash lines with an angled eye brush, and directly along the water lines with the pencil itself

STEP 5: Eyeshadow in Mushroom applied in the inner corners with a flat eyeshadow brush

STEP 6: Urban Decay 24/7 Glide-On Eye Pencil in Mushroom (also from the Ocho Loco set) applied on the lower water line

STEP 7: Brows and mascara

Mission complete!
